O WhatsApp é uma das ferramentas de comunicação mais poderosas para empresas que buscam otimizar o relacionamento com seus clientes. Com a crescente demanda por interações rápidas, personalizadas e automatizadas, a construção de fluxos automatizados — conhecidos como WhatsApp Flows — se tornou essencial para garantir eficiência e escalabilidade no atendimento. A AgeuBot, referência em automação para WhatsApp, traz neste guia técnico uma abordagem detalhada sobre a estrutura de JSON utilizada para criar esses fluxos, além de explorar casos de uso avançados que vão elevar o nível das suas automações.
Entender a estrutura de JSON por trás dos WhatsApp Flows é fundamental para desenvolvedores, analistas e gestores que desejam ir além das soluções básicas e construir interações mais inteligentes e integradas. A capacidade de manipular objetos, variáveis e condições dentro do fluxo permite criar jornadas personalizadas, que se adaptam ao comportamento do usuário e às necessidades específicas do negócio. Assim, além de melhorar a experiência do cliente, a automação contribui para a redução de custos operacionais.
Este guia técnico foi elaborado para oferecer uma visão completa e aprofundada do tema, com exemplos práticos, tabelas comparativas, dicas de implementação e insights estratégicos. Acompanhe e descubra como a AgeuBot pode ajudar sua empresa a dominar as melhores práticas em automação via WhatsApp, utilizando JSON para criar fluxos robustos, flexíveis e com alto impacto comercial.
O que são WhatsApp Flows e sua importância na automação
Os WhatsApp Flows representam o conjunto de interações automatizadas que guiam o usuário por uma jornada pré-definida, seja para atendimento, vendas ou suporte. São compostos por mensagens, respostas rápidas, menus, validações e integrações, que funcionam de forma sequencial ou condicional.
Ao utilizar esses fluxos, as empresas conseguem:
- Oferecer atendimento 24 horas com respostas imediatas;
- Personalizar interações com base no perfil e comportamento do cliente;
- Automatizar processos repetitivos, liberando a equipe para tarefas complexas;
- Integrar o WhatsApp com sistemas internos, como CRMs e ERPs;
- Coletar dados valiosos para análise e melhoria contínua.
Por isso, dominar a estrutura dos WhatsApp Flows é uma habilidade técnica que traz ganhos significativos em performance e experiência do usuário.
Estrutura de JSON no WhatsApp Flows: fundamentos e componentes
O formato JSON (JavaScript Object Notation) é a base para a construção e configuração dos WhatsApp Flows na maioria das plataformas, incluindo a AgeuBot. Ele permite descrever de forma organizada e legível as etapas, condições e ações que compõem o fluxo.
Um fluxo em JSON é composto por:
- Nodes (nós): unidades que representam mensagens, decisões, ações ou integrações;
- Transitions (transições): regras que determinam o caminho entre os nodes, geralmente baseadas em respostas do usuário ou condições;
- Variables (variáveis): elementos que armazenam dados coletados ou gerados durante o fluxo, usados para personalização e lógica;
- Actions (ações): comandos executados, como chamadas a APIs externas, envio de notificações ou atualização de dados.
Exemplo simplificado de JSON para um node de mensagem
{
"id": "msg_1",
"type": "message",
"content": {
"text": "Olá! Como podemos ajudar você hoje?"
},
"transitions": [
{
"condition": "true",
"next": "option_menu"
}
]
}
Este exemplo mostra um node básico que envia uma mensagem e, automaticamente, direciona para o node "option_menu".
Principais tipos de nodes e suas funções avançadas
No desenvolvimento de WhatsApp Flows, diferentes tipos de nodes são usados para criar experiências ricas e adaptativas. Conhecer cada tipo e suas possibilidades é essencial para construir automações robustas.
Message Node
Envia mensagens de texto, imagens, documentos, áudios e vídeos para o usuário. Pode conter botões interativos e links.
Input Node
Captura entradas do usuário, como texto, números, opções selecionadas ou até localização.
Condition Node
Permite criar ramificações no fluxo com base em variáveis ou respostas anteriores, permitindo decisões dinâmicas.
Action Node
Executa ações externas, como chamadas a APIs REST, integração com sistemas de CRM, envio de e-mails, ou atualização de banco de dados.
Loop Node
Repetição de ações ou mensagens, útil para fluxos que necessitam de tentativas múltiplas ou processos iterativos.
Casos de uso avançados para WhatsApp Flows com JSON
Além das funções básicas, os WhatsApp Flows podem ser aplicados em situações complexas, trazendo automações inteligentes para processos de vendas, atendimento e marketing.
1. Qualificação automática de leads
- Captura informações essenciais via perguntas sequenciais;
- Utiliza condições para segmentar o lead em categorias;
- Dispara mensagens personalizadas conforme o perfil identificado.
Essa automação permite um processo de qualificação eficiente, reduzindo o esforço manual da equipe comercial.
2. Recuperação de carrinho abandonado
- Integração com e-commerce para identificar carrinhos não finalizados;
- Envio de mensagens de lembrete com ofertas especiais;
- Incorporação de botões para facilitar a finalização da compra.
Com isso, o WhatsApp se torna um canal poderoso para recuperar vendas, como detalhado no nosso post sobre Recuperar Carrinho.
3. Agendamento automático de serviços
- Coleta de dados do cliente e preferências de data/hora;
- Validação automática de disponibilidade via integração com sistemas;
- Confirmação e lembretes enviados automaticamente.
Esses fluxos aumentam a eficiência operacional e melhoram a experiência do cliente, conforme explicado em Agendamento Automático.
Boas práticas na construção de fluxos JSON para WhatsApp
Desenvolver WhatsApp Flows eficientes requer atenção a detalhes técnicos e estratégicos para evitar erros e maximizar resultados.
- Organização do JSON: mantenha a estrutura clara, com identações e comentários para facilitar manutenção;
- Uso consciente de variáveis: evite sobrecarga com muitas variáveis não utilizadas;
- Tratamento de exceções: implemente nodes para lidar com respostas inesperadas ou erros de integração;
- Validação de inputs: garanta que os dados fornecidos pelo usuário estejam no formato correto antes de avançar;
- Teste contínuo: realize testes completos para identificar falhas e otimizar a experiência do usuário.
Comparativo: JSON vs outras formas de criação de fluxos no WhatsApp
Apesar do JSON ser o formato padrão e mais flexível para montagem de fluxos, outras abordagens existem e podem ser escolhidas conforme o contexto e a plataforma. Veja a comparação abaixo:
| Aspecto | JSON | Construtores Visuais | Scripts Customizados |
|---|---|---|---|
| Flexibilidade | Alta: permite lógica complexa e integrações avançadas | Média: limitado às opções do construtor | Alta: pode criar qualquer lógica, mas requer programação |
| Curva de aprendizado | Média: requer conhecimento técnico em JSON | Baixa: interface amigável para não programadores | Alta: exige programação avançada |
| Manutenção | Moderada: organização do JSON é fundamental | Fácil: visual e intuitiva | Complexa: depende da documentação do código |
| Integrações | Alta: permite chamadas diretas a APIs externas | Limitada: depende das integrações suportadas | Alta: pode integrar qualquer serviço |
| Escalabilidade | Alta: ideal para fluxos grandes e complexos | Média: pode ficar confuso com fluxos extensos | Alta: depende da arquitetura do código |
Principais desafios e como superá-los na automação com WhatsApp Flows
Apesar das vantagens, a criação de fluxos automatizados pode apresentar desafios técnicos e estratégicos. Conhecer esses obstáculos e como superá-los é crucial para o sucesso.
- Limitações de tamanho do JSON: divida fluxos muito grandes em subfluxos para manter a performance;
- Gerenciamento de variáveis: use nomenclaturas claras e documente cada variável para evitar confusões;
- Tratamento de respostas imprevisíveis: implemente mensagens de fallback para orientar o usuário;
- Atualizações constantes na API: mantenha-se atualizado com as mudanças no WhatsApp API e novas funcionalidades para aproveitar os recursos;
- Segurança e conformidade: garanta conformidade com a LGPD no WhatsApp e proteja os dados dos clientes.
"Automatizar o atendimento no WhatsApp com fluxos bem construídos é a chave para transformar a comunicação em um diferencial competitivo real."
Conclusão
Dominar a estrutura de JSON para criação de WhatsApp Flows é essencial para empresas que desejam explorar todo o potencial da automação via WhatsApp. Com conhecimentos técnicos avançados e aplicação estratégica, é possível elevar a eficiência do atendimento, qualificar leads automaticamente, recuperar vendas e garantir uma experiência personalizada para o cliente.
A AgeuBot oferece as ferramentas e o suporte necessários para que sua empresa construa fluxos inteligentes, escaláveis e alinhados às melhores práticas do mercado. Aproveite este guia para aprofundar seu conhecimento e transformar a comunicação com seus clientes.
Pronto para transformar seu WhatsApp em uma máquina de vendas?
Começar Teste Gratuito de 7 Dias